What is the purpose of the drunk driving scene in the great gatsby?

English
2 answers:
IgorC [24]3 years ago
8 0
This scene occurs after Gatsby's party showing that everyone was so drunk and in the moment. feeling like they are better than everyone else and not caring
erik [133]3 years ago
6 0

it shows that although ppl know that drunk driving isn't safe, they still do it, just like how they know that the economic thing will go down soon if they dont safe their money but they still party. i hope this is helpful!
